Bhopal (Madhya Pradesh): The draft Master Plan for Bhopal and Indore remained incomplete till March 31.
During the budget session, Urban Development Minister Kailash Vijayvargiya announced in the House that the Master Plan would be given final touches by the end of this month.

The Master Plan for Bhopal and Indore was yet to be presented to Chief Minister Mohan Yadav.
Vijayvargiya held a meeting over the Master Plan of Indore. Proposals for some amendments in the draft also figured in the discussion.
The draft of Bhopal Master is ready with the Urban Development. So, when it is presented to Yadav, there will be some amendments in it.
Afterwards, the draft Master Plan for Bhopal and Indore will be published. When the new government was formed last year, Vijayvargiya cancelled the draft Master Plan.
The committee for the Master Plan was reformed in August last year
Vijayvargiya told the department to prepare the Master Plan according to the requirements of 2047 instead of 2031. The deadline for preparing the Master Plan was December 31 last year. The committee for the Master Plan was reformed in August last year.
Bhopal and Indore to be metropolitan cities
Chief Minister Mohan Yadav said Bhopal and Indore would be developed into metropolitan cities.
According to the CM’s announcement, a few nearby areas of Bhopal and those of Indore would be added to these cities to develop them into metros.
Nevertheless, the government is in a dilemma over whether the draft Master Plan of both the cities will be according to the metropolitan city or it will be released before that happens.
If some areas of Raisen, Sehore, Vidisha and Rajgarh are added to Bhopal, it will take time to prepare the Master Plan for the state capital.
Similarly, if some areas of Dhar, Dewas, and Ujjain are included in Indore, it will take a long time to get the Master Plan of the city ready.
